It provides essential data need to transmit the data. LE. WebMay 17, 2024 · Flag. In computer science, a flag is a value that acts as a signal for a function or process. The value of the flag is used to determine the next step of a program. Flags are often binary flags, which contain a boolean value (true or false). However, not all flags are binary, meaning they can store a range of values.

WebBit stuffing is the insertion of one or more bit s into a transmission unit as a way to provide signaling information to a receiver. The receiver knows how to detect and remove or disregard the stuffed bits. WebNov 11, 2024 · Here the sending computer transmit data to the data link layer which forms a frame from the data received. Using the bit stuffing technique, we added extra bits and send the frame to the receiver computer. When the receiver computer receives the frame, it deletes the extra added bits from the payload and processes further. 5.
